For the 13th time since 2010, Boys' Latin and McDonogh will meet in the playoffs, as the two MIAA rivals are now set to square off in Friday's championship after each side eeked out wins in the semifinals.
In the first of two games at Navy-Marine Corps Stadium on Tuesday night, Gilman gave BL all it could handle, only trailing 7-6 heading into the half and even taking a 9-8 lead late in the third quarter. From there, however, BL cracked the Greyhounds' defense and scored five straight to the end of the game, propelled by timely face-off wins and goals from its most experienced weapons.
